Damp housing stats highlight need for greater supply of good homes
The latest statistics on damp houses highlight the need for permanent, affordable homes that are warm, dry and good to live in – and available to all New Zealanders, says Scott Figenshow, Chief Executive of Community Housing Aotearoa.
Recommendations are based on PPE guidance from Ministry of Health and Ministry of Social Development. With any face to face contact, we recommend you call ahead before you meet or stand at a 2-metre distance and ask the following questions:
If you are not going to get closer than 2 metres, there is no need to wear PPE.
